Transaction 881afc00253ed5427898d10b5630d89fe4878b48446e981ebc7c3a3eeef613a2
1 Input
2 Outputs
- 881afc00253ed5427898d10b5630d89fe4878b48446e981ebc7c3a3eeef613a2:0
- 881afc00253ed5427898d10b5630d89fe4878b48446e981ebc7c3a3eeef613a2:1
value 1300052693
address 1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Y
value 0
address